Job Overview: 

The Reach Lift Operator is responsible for moving product within the warehouse. A Reach Lift operator at UNFI is required to have a strong understanding of their lift, the loads they are carrying, productivity measures and safety procedures.

Essential Functions and Basic Duties: 

·         Reports to the shipping office at the beginning of each shift for the daily assignment, vehicle inspection sheet and replenishment discrepancies sheet

·         Inspects assigned lift and completes vehicle inspection sheet

·         Replenishes pick slots using the view request screen. If no requests exist, uses the manual replenish screen to fill empty or almost empty slots

·         Performs knockdowns for selectors when needed

·         Maintains correct counts and logs any discrepancies in inventory

·         Verifies that the correct product is being put in the appropriate pick location

·         Cuts and removes shrink wrap from all knockdowns

·         Removes all empty pallets from pick locations and aisles. Separates the good, bad, and blue pallets and neatly stages in pallet staging area

·         Operates the lift in a safe and efficient manner

·         Perform duties in accordance with Hazard Analysis Critical Control Points (HACCP) and Safe Quality Food (SQF) policies and procedures, as appropriate for location
